This car is very quiet.
I was sitting in traffic on the BQE as usual with all these trucks around me and the cabin stayed quiet. I turned the music off and just sat there. It felt like there was no cars around you.
And on the turnpike going 80mph it felt quiet also. In my previous cars I had to turn the music on loud just so I don't hear the wind noise.

Very very super duper quiet.There is a layer of something between the windshield glass that really cuts down the noise inside the car. Someone here said he tested it out by facing the traffic and couldn't hear anything, then turned parallel to the traffic and heard more noise in the car.
Also lots of insulation. In my 96TL, when it rained hard, I could hardly hear the radio. First time it rained hard while driving my 04TL, it took me a long time to realize that this was not happening, and I could barely hear any noise from the rain hitting the roof or windshield.
I agree... very soothing ride. I noticed that the body panels are foam filled which helps insulate for reducing noise. Just look in your door jam and you will see that the front quarter panel has foam insulation.
